Cluey 1 Hour Tutoring Sessions
Weekly learning through live tutoring sessions, feedback & practice
Each student’s individual learning journey is supported through a series of live face-to-face sessions with an expert tutor matched to the student's needs. We cover all the theory and examples needed to ensure comprehension, and our sessions are designed to be engaging and encouraging.
Our expert tutors offer guidance through demonstration and worked examples and assign targeted practice questions to help students master the topics and concepts covered.
After each session, personalised feedback is provided to help students and parents track their progress.
Session breakdown
First 5 Minutes
Establishing the session theme, why are we here?
- Discuss student’s areas of focus (if first session)
- Review previous session's assigned practice (if subsequent session)
- Set session learning goals
45 Minutes
During the session
- Work through exercises based on the topics and concepts for each learning goal
- Tutor demonstrates, guides and explains concepts
- Work through any challenges
- Students are encouraged to explain their thinking to clarify their comprehension
Closing 5 Minutes
Reflection and looking ahead
- Reflect on what has been achieved in the session
- Set practice questions
Post-session 5 minutes
Tutor written feedback
- Tutor provides personalised written feedback about the session to help track progress
